### Checklist: ScanLark barcode bridge

- [ ] Confirm the ScanLark plugin handshake works against both the v3 and legacy scanner firmware — plugin folks, don't skip the legacy path, it still bites.
- [ ] Run the symbology sweep (EAN, Code 128, QR) on the Bramleyfield test rig.
- [ ] Paste the promoted build's token where indicated beneath this line.

pipeline stamp: htk31_f769b577b3028a4e9958e5bb8d1259a

Subject: Handover — PruneBot review notes

Marek,

Taking over PruneBot while Ilva is out. For your review pass: the stale-branch cleanup bot scans repos nightly, flags branches idle 90+ days, and deletes after a two-week grace window. Deletion events are logged to the audit table, not just stdout — check the reviewer checklist covers that. Dry-run mode is on in staging. Schema migrations are in the pending/ folder. The audit database is reachable via the connection string below.

primary connection of yagep-kahip = redis://giliel_svc:zYiKsLL2PLpfPL@db-348f.xolmarsys.corp:5432/fenwyn

This alert fires when a merge to a protected branch introduces an unpinned or range-pinned dependency. Thistledown policy requires exact versions with checksums in the lockfile; floating ranges and git refs without a commit hash are rejected. The alert blocks the merge queue until resolved. Reviewers should not approve exemptions inline — exemptions require an entry in the pinning waiver registry with an expiry date. The policy text, waiver process, and known false positives are documented on the internal page below.

wiki page, fahaf-yagag: https://confluence.qorvellabs.internal/pages/display/pages/display

Ticket: Reception desk is moving down to the ground floor of Pellant House tonight. Movers from Garrow Logistics arrive around 22:00 — let them in via the side lobby and keep the lift free. Old first-floor desk stays locked until morning. For the ground-floor lobby door, use the temporary pass below.

badge for hahaf-yajop: bdg-IWTUR-3

# Artifact Signing — Pickwise Optimizer

The Pickwise warehouse pick-list optimizer ships as a signed container to every fulfillment site. Unsigned images are rejected by the site agents, so signing is not optional. New team members should build from the release branch, run the route-quality checks, and confirm the manifest digest matches the CI output. When the digest matches, sign the image using the deploy key below.

rollout seal: bky4_DFM9